In triangle ABC, DE is parallel to BC. If AD = 1.5 cm, DB = 3 cm and AE = 1 cm, find EC.

Step-by-Step Solution
Step 1: Identify Similar Triangles
Given that DE is parallel to BC, we can conclude that triangle ADE is similar to triangle ABC. This is because corresponding angles are equal (angle D = angle B, angle E = angle C, and angle A is common). This is known as the AA similarity criterion.
Step 2: Apply Basic Proportionality Theorem
According to the Basic Proportionality Theorem (also known as Thales Theorem or the Intercept Theorem), if a line parallel to one side of a triangle intersects the other two sides, then it divides the two sides proportionally.
Step 3: Substitute Known Values
We are given AD=1.5 cm, DB=3 cm, and AE=1 cm. Substitute these values into the proportionality equation.
Step 4: Solve for EC
Now, we solve the equation for EC. Cross-multiply the terms and then isolate EC to find its value.
